Hyperpigmentation happens when your skin produces extra melanin in specific areas, usually after inflammation, sun damage, or hormonal changes. This creates those stubborn dark patches that seem to stick around long after the original trigger is gone. The good news is that bearberry extract for skin and mulberry extract for dark spots work by targeting the same pathways that professional treatments do, just more gently.
Bearberry leaves contain alpha arbutin bearberry compounds that act as natural tyrosinase inhibitors. Tyrosinase is the enzyme responsible for melanin production, so when you slow it down, you reduce the formation of new dark spots while existing ones gradually fade. This makes bearberry one of the most effective skin lightening ingredients found in nature.
Mulberry contains mulberroside F and natural arbutin, similar to bearberry but with added antioxidant benefits. These compounds not only help with reducing dark patches on skin but also protect against the free radical damage that can trigger new pigmentation. This dual action makes mulberry particularly valuable for long-term skin tone evening solutions.
These remedies range from simple preparations you can make in minutes to more complex treatments that require a bit more time and effort. Start with the simpler options to see how your skin responds before moving to the more intensive treatments.
This is the gentlest way to introduce bearberry to your routine. Steep 2 tablespoons of dried bearberry leaves in hot water for 15 minutes, strain, and let cool. Soak cotton pads in the tea and apply to dark spots for 10-15 minutes daily. The mild concentration makes this perfect for sensitive skin or first-time users of herbal remedies for melasma.
Mix 1 tablespoon of bearberry leaf powder with 2 tablespoons of raw honey. The honey helps the bearberry penetrate better while providing additional moisture. Apply this mask twice weekly, leaving it on for 20 minutes before rinsing with lukewarm water. Results typically appear after 3-4 weeks of consistent use.
For a more concentrated treatment, create an oil infusion by combining dried bearberry leaves with jojoba or sweet almond oil. Heat gently for 2 hours, strain, and store in a dark bottle. This DIY skin brightening serum can be applied nightly to target specific areas of pigmentation.
Blend fresh mulberry leaves with distilled water, strain through cheesecloth, and store in the refrigerator for up to one week. This gentle toner provides daily delivery of mulberry's active compounds without irritation. Use morning and evening after cleansing for best results with this natural hyperpigmentation treatment.
Combine mulberry leaf extract with fermented rice water for a traditional approach to skin brightening. Rice water contains kojic acid, which works synergistically with mulberry's compounds. This combination has been used for centuries as one of the most effective hyperpigmentation home remedies in Asian skincare traditions.
When fresh mulberries are in season, mash the fruit into a pulp and apply directly to clean skin. The natural fruit acids provide gentle exfoliation while the mulberry compounds work on pigmentation. Leave on for 15 minutes, then rinse thoroughly. This seasonal treatment offers both immediate glow and long-term brightening benefits.
Create a more sophisticated treatment by combining both extracts in a cream base. Mix equal parts bearberry and mulberry tinctures with unscented moisturizer or aloe vera gel. This combination maximizes the skin tone evening solutions potential of both ingredients while providing hydration that prevents irritation.
For advanced users, combine bearberry extract, mulberry extract, and vitamin C powder in a hyaluronic acid serum base. This creates a potent treatment that rivals professional formulations. Use every other night initially, building up to daily use as your skin adjusts to this intensive natural hyperpigmentation treatment.
Mix bearberry powder, mulberry extract, and a small amount of glycerin into a paste. Apply to clean skin before bed, focusing on areas of hyperpigmentation. The extended contact time allows for deeper penetration of active compounds. Use 2-3 times per week for this intensive approach to reducing dark patches on skin.
Natural doesn't always mean gentle, so proper preparation and application are crucial for both safety and effectiveness. Always start with lower concentrations and shorter contact times to assess your skin's tolerance.
Before trying any new remedy, apply a small amount to your inner forearm and wait 24 hours. Look for redness, itching, or irritation. This step is especially important when using concentrated extracts or combining multiple active ingredients in your DIY skin brightening routine.
Both bearberry and mulberry can increase photosensitivity, making your skin more susceptible to sun damage. Always use broad-spectrum SPF 30 or higher during the day when using these treatments. This protection is essential for preventing new pigmentation while you're working to fade existing spots.
Most people notice initial improvements in skin brightness after 2-3 weeks of consistent use. Significant fading of dark spots typically occurs after 6-8 weeks. Remember that natural treatments work more slowly than chemical alternatives, but they're also gentler on your skin.
